Its airport with direct service to the mainland, world-class resorts and golfing, deep-sea fishing and historic landmarks make this an ideal setting for the University’s West Hawaiʻi center. Kailua-Kona, on the western side of Hawaiʻi Island, is one of the fastest growing population centers in the State. ![]() It is located 200 air miles from Honolulu, Hawaiʻi’s state capital. Hilo, which has a major harbor and airport, is a peaceful city with a population of 43,000. The island’s economy is centered largely on agriculture and tourism. Its marine environment, geological diversity and cultural richness are valuable and well utilized educational resources by the faculty and administration. Located in the Pacific Ocean, Hawaiʻi Island is almost 2,500 miles from the mainland U.S.A. With its great variety of physical features, including peaks that are snowcapped in winter, pasture lands, sugarcane fields, active volcanoes, and rain-swept valleys, the Big Island of Hawaiʻi has been described as a tropical mini-continent. With an area of 4,060 square miles, it has more land than all the other Hawaiian islands combined. The University of Hawaiʻi at Hilo is situated on the island of Hawaiʻi, the largest in the Hawaiian Archipelago.
